About This Study
This is a prospective cohort study in which the standard verbal informed consent process for ketamine sedation is compared to a multimedia informed consent process. The goals include determining if parents prefer a multimedia consent process and evaluating the effectiveness of multimedia consent process.

Eligibility
Age:1 Year - 18 Years
Healthy Volunteers:No
View full eligibility criteria
Inclusion Criteria: * Receiving ketamine sedation for fracture reduction * Less than 18 years of age * English as primary language Exclusion Criteria: * patients who received medications in addition to ketamine for sedation * Families where English was not the primary language
